项目作者: pureone-tcy
项目描述 :
Build ELK Stack in a local environment.
高级语言: TSQL
项目地址: git://github.com/pureone-tcy/elastic-stack-container.git
ELK Stack
- コンテナに、ELK Stack (v7.2) の環境を構築するプロジェクト
Logstash File input plugin
より、logstash/pipeline/input/
配下のjsonファイルをElasticsearchへ自動的にプッシュする- Kibanaで可視化して遊ぶ
Run
$ docker-compose up -d
// 10分〜30分くらい掛かります
Config
logstash/pipeline/logstash.conf
logstash/pipeline/template/index_template.json
Add Data / Update Data
logstash/pipeline/input/*.json
Stop
$ docker-compose stop
Delete
$ docker-compose down
$ docker images
REPOSITORY TAG IMAGE ID
docker.elastic.co/logstash/logstash 7.2.0 4470777ac65e
docker.elastic.co/kibana/kibana 7.2.0 3e581a516dcd
docker.elastic.co/elasticsearch/elasticsearch 7.2.0 0efa6a3de177
$ docker rmi IMAGE ID